「/etc/cron.d/sysstat」と「/etc/cron.d/raid-check」

Linuxコマンドcron

目次一覧

 状態:-  閲覧数:274  投稿日:2019-04-24  更新日:2019-04-24
/etc/cron.d/sysstat / /etc/cron.d/raid-check / cron再起動

/etc/cron.d/sysstat / /etc/cron.d/raid-check / cron再起動

 閲覧数:119 投稿日:2019-04-24 更新日:2019-04-24 

/etc/cron.d/sysstat


デフォルト処理内容を確認
・デフォルト設定では、10分間隔でリソース状態を一か月間分記録する
$ sudo less /etc/cron.d/sysstat
# Run system activity accounting tool every 10 minutes
*/10 * * * * root /usr/lib64/sa/sa1 1 1
# 0 * * * * root /usr/lib64/sa/sa1 600 6 &
# Generate a daily summary of process accounting at 23:53
53 23 * * * root /usr/lib64/sa/sa2 -A


$ ls -l /var/log/sa
合計 22540
-rw-r--r-- 1 root root 442976  4月  1 23:50 sa01
-rw-r--r-- 1 root root 442976  4月  2 23:50 sa02
-rw-r--r-- 1 root root 442976  4月  3 23:50 sa03
-rw-r--r-- 1 root root 442976  4月  4 23:50 sa04
-rw-r--r-- 1 root root 442976  4月  5 23:50 sa05
-rw-r--r-- 1 root root 442976  4月  6 23:50 sa06
-rw-r--r-- 1 root root 442976  4月  7 23:50 sa07
-rw-r--r-- 1 root root 442976  4月  8 23:50 sa08
-rw-r--r-- 1 root root 442976  4月  9 23:50 sa09
-rw-r--r-- 1 root root 442976  4月 10 23:50 sa10
-rw-r--r-- 1 root root 442976  4月 11 23:50 sa11
-rw-r--r-- 1 root root 442976  4月 12 23:50 sa12
-rw-r--r-- 1 root root 442976  4月 13 23:50 sa13
-rw-r--r-- 1 root root 442976  4月 14 23:50 sa14
-rw-r--r-- 1 root root 442976  4月 15 23:50 sa15
-rw-r--r-- 1 root root 442976  4月 16 23:50 sa16
-rw-r--r-- 1 root root 442976  4月 17 23:50 sa17
-rw-r--r-- 1 root root 442976  4月 18 23:50 sa18
-rw-r--r-- 1 root root 442976  4月 19 23:50 sa19
-rw-r--r-- 1 root root 442976  4月 20 23:50 sa20
-rw-r--r-- 1 root root 442976  4月 21 23:50 sa21
-rw-r--r-- 1 root root 442976  4月 22 23:50 sa22
-rw-r--r-- 1 root root 442976  4月 23 23:50 sa23
-rw-r--r-- 1 root root 227936  4月 24 12:10 sa24
-rw-r--r-- 1 root root 442976  3月 26 23:50 sa26
-rw-r--r-- 1 root root 442976  3月 27 23:50 sa27
-rw-r--r-- 1 root root 442976  3月 28 23:50 sa28
-rw-r--r-- 1 root root 442976  3月 29 23:50 sa29
-rw-r--r-- 1 root root 442976  3月 30 23:50 sa30
-rw-r--r-- 1 root root 442976  3月 31 23:50 sa31
-rw-r--r-- 1 root root 338800  4月  1 23:53 sar01
-rw-r--r-- 1 root root 338800  4月  2 23:53 sar02
-rw-r--r-- 1 root root 338800  4月  3 23:53 sar03
-rw-r--r-- 1 root root 338800  4月  4 23:53 sar04
-rw-r--r-- 1 root root 338800  4月  5 23:53 sar05
-rw-r--r-- 1 root root 338800  4月  6 23:53 sar06
-rw-r--r-- 1 root root 338800  4月  7 23:53 sar07
-rw-r--r-- 1 root root 338800  4月  8 23:53 sar08
-rw-r--r-- 1 root root 338800  4月  9 23:53 sar09
-rw-r--r-- 1 root root 338800  4月 10 23:53 sar10
-rw-r--r-- 1 root root 338800  4月 11 23:53 sar11
-rw-r--r-- 1 root root 338800  4月 12 23:53 sar12
-rw-r--r-- 1 root root 338800  4月 13 23:53 sar13
-rw-r--r-- 1 root root 338800  4月 14 23:53 sar14
-rw-r--r-- 1 root root 338800  4月 15 23:53 sar15
-rw-r--r-- 1 root root 338800  4月 16 23:53 sar16
-rw-r--r-- 1 root root 338800  4月 17 23:53 sar17
-rw-r--r-- 1 root root 338800  4月 18 23:53 sar18
-rw-r--r-- 1 root root 338800  4月 19 23:53 sar19
-rw-r--r-- 1 root root 338800  4月 20 23:53 sar20
-rw-r--r-- 1 root root 338800  4月 21 23:53 sar21
-rw-r--r-- 1 root root 338800  4月 22 23:53 sar22
-rw-r--r-- 1 root root 338800  4月 23 23:53 sar23
-rw-r--r-- 1 root root 338800  3月 26 23:53 sar26
-rw-r--r-- 1 root root 338800  3月 27 23:53 sar27
-rw-r--r-- 1 root root 338800  3月 28 23:53 sar28
-rw-r--r-- 1 root root 338800  3月 29 23:53 sar29
-rw-r--r-- 1 root root 338800  3月 30 23:53 sar30
-rw-r--r-- 1 root root 338800  3月 31 23:53 sar31


リソース消費具合の確認に役立つかと思ったが、
・詳細過ぎて、私には難し過ぎる
$ less /var/log/sa/sar23
00時00分04秒     CPU      %usr     %nice      %sys   %iowait    %steal      %irq     %soft    %guest    %gnice     %idle
00時10分03秒     all     49.08      0.00      0.93     21.64      0.03      0.00      0.01      0.00      0.00     28.31
00時10分03秒       0     91.22      0.00      0.33      7.47      0.02      0.00      0.01      0.00      0.00      0.96
00時10分03秒       1      6.78      0.00      1.55     35.85      0.04      0.00      0.02      0.00      0.00     55.76
00時20分03秒     all     48.52      0.00      0.98     22.46      0.03      0.00      0.01      0.00      0.00     28.01
00時20分03秒       0     88.17      0.00      0.45      9.29      0.02      0.00      0.00      0.00      0.00      2.08
00時20分03秒       1      8.73      0.00      1.51     35.67      0.04      0.00      0.02      0.00      0.00     54.03
00時30分02秒     all     48.57      0.00      0.40     11.23      0.03      0.00      0.01      0.00      0.00     39.76
00時30分02秒       0     92.48      0.00      0.06      2.70      0.02      0.00      0.00      0.00      0.00      4.73
00時30分02秒       1      4.58      0.00      0.74     19.78      0.04      0.00      0.01      0.00      0.00     74.86
00時40分02秒     all     47.36      0.00      0.81     21.90      0.03      0.00      0.01      0.00      0.00     29.89
00時40分02秒       0     73.27      0.00      0.59     15.29      0.03      0.00      0.01      0.00      0.00     10.81
00時40分02秒       1     21.42      0.00      1.03     28.51      0.03      0.00      0.02      0.00      0.00     48.99
00時50分01秒     all     49.15      0.00      0.41      9.61      0.02      0.00      0.01      0.00      0.00     40.80
00時50分01秒       0     84.02      0.00      0.19      6.79      0.02      0.00      0.01      0.00      0.00      8.97
00時50分01秒       1     14.24      0.00      0.62     12.43      0.03      0.00      0.01      0.00      0.00     72.68
01時00分03秒     all     49.35      0.00      0.63     15.88      0.05      0.00      0.01      0.00      0.00     34.08
01時00分03秒       0     88.14      0.00      0.25      6.53      0.04      0.00      0.00      0.00      0.00      5.03
01時00分03秒       1     10.49      0.00      1.01     25.25      0.06      0.00      0.02      0.00      0.00     63.18
//以下略


コメントアウト
$ sudo vi /etc/cron.d/sysstat
# Run system activity accounting tool every 10 minutes
# */10 * * * * root /usr/lib64/sa/sa1 1 1
# 0 * * * * root /usr/lib64/sa/sa1 600 6 &
# Generate a daily summary of process accounting at 23:53
# 53 23 * * * root /usr/lib64/sa/sa2 -A



/etc/cron.d/raid-check


デフォルト処理内容を確認
$ less /etc/cron.d/raid-check
# Run system wide raid-check once a week on Sunday at 1am by default
0 1 * * Sun root /usr/sbin/raid-check


コメントアウト
$ sudo vi /etc/cron.d/raid-check
# Run system wide raid-check once a week on Sunday at 1am by default
# 0 1 * * Sun root /usr/sbin/raid-check


$ service crond status
Redirecting to /bin/systemctl status  crond.service
● crond.service - Command Scheduler
Loaded: loaded (/usr/lib/systemd/system/crond.service; enabled; vendor preset: enabled)
Active: active (running) since 土 2019-04-20 01:01:06 JST; 4 days ago
Main PID: 22392 (crond)
CGroup: /system.slice/crond.service
└─22392 /usr/sbin/crond -n

4月 23 01:35:07 hoge.vs.sakura.ne.jp crond[22392]: postdrop: warning: uid=0: File too large
4月 23 01:35:08 hoge.vs.sakura.ne.jp crond[22392]: sendmail: fatal: root(0): message file too big
4月 23 12:00:02 hoge.vs.sakura.ne.jp crond[22392]: (python) ERROR (getpwnam() failed)
4月 24 00:00:01 hoge.vs.sakura.ne.jp crond[22392]: (python) ERROR (getpwnam() failed)
4月 24 01:26:33 hoge.vs.sakura.ne.jp crond[22392]: postdrop: warning: uid=0: File too large
4月 24 01:26:34 hoge.vs.sakura.ne.jp crond[22392]: sendmail: fatal: root(0): message file too big
4月 24 12:00:01 hoge.vs.sakura.ne.jp crond[22392]: (python) ERROR (getpwnam() failed)
4月 24 12:36:01 hoge.vs.sakura.ne.jp crond[22392]: (*system*) RELOAD (/etc/cron.d/sysstat)
4月 24 12:47:01 hoge.vs.sakura.ne.jp crond[22392]: (*system*) RELOAD (/etc/cron.d/raid-check)
4月 24 12:48:01 hoge.vs.sakura.ne.jp crond[22392]: (*system*) RELOAD (/etc/cron.d/sysstat)


cron再起動


$ sudo systemctl restart crond

$ service crond status
Redirecting to /bin/systemctl status  crond.service
● crond.service - Command Scheduler
Loaded: loaded (/usr/lib/systemd/system/crond.service; enabled; vendor preset: enabled)
Active: active (running) since 水 2019-04-24 12:51:46 JST; 4s ago
Main PID: 19105 (crond)
CGroup: /system.slice/crond.service
└─19105 /usr/sbin/crond -n

4月 24 12:51:46 hoge.vs.sakura.ne.jp systemd[1]: Started Command Scheduler.
4月 24 12:51:46 hoge.vs.sakura.ne.jp systemd[1]: Starting Command Scheduler...
4月 24 12:51:46 hoge.vs.sakura.ne.jp crond[19105]: (CRON) INFO (RANDOM_DELAY will be scaled with f...d.)
4月 24 12:51:46 hoge.vs.sakura.ne.jp crond[19105]: (CRON) INFO (running with inotify support)
4月 24 12:51:46 hoge.vs.sakura.ne.jp crond[19105]: (CRON) INFO (@reboot jobs will be run at comput...p.)
Hint: Some lines were ellipsized, use -l to show in full.



「/etc/cron.d/raid-check」と「/etc/cron.d/sysstat」について



「cron × Cent OS7」でよく使用するコマンド

それまで受信できていたcron経由によるメールを、正常受信できなくなった原因



週間人気ページランキング / 9-14 → 9-20
順位 ページタイトル抜粋 アクセス数
1 PHPのmb_send_mail関数でメール送信できない | メール処理システム 29
2 Nginx設定。エラーログレベル | Nginx(Webサーバ) 21
3 Python 3.5 アンインストール / yum remove | Python(プログラミング言語) 11
4 FFmpeg 2.8.15 を yum インストール | ソフトウェアスイート 10
5 PHP実行ユーザ設定 / CentOS6 / Apache | PHP(プログラミング言語) 9
6 PHP Version 7.1.2 php-mecabエクステンション対応 / PHP 7.0.14 からのアップグレード  | MeCab(形態素解析) 8
6 ソースからビルドしたPython 2.7.3 アンインストール失敗 | Python(プログラミング言語) 8
7 touch コマンド / viコマンド。新規ファイル作成時の違い | Linuxコマンド 7
7 さくらVPS0 7
8 9回目-13.MySQL5.7.21設定 | CentOS 7 2週間無料のお試し期間 9回目(さくらVPS) 6
8 「設定ファイルに、暗号化 (blowfish_secret) 用の非公開パスフレーズの設定を必要とするようになりました。」対応 6
9 PHPファイルでchmodエラー | PHP(プログラミング言語) 5
9 設定 2019/1/22 / 一般ユーザがmailコマンドでメール送信 / 管理者がmailコマンドでメール送信 5
10 Postfix | メール処理システム 4
10 CentOSでcpコマンド動作確認するためには、Control + T ではなく、 -v オプションを使用 | cp(Linuxコマンド) 4
10 499 (Request has been forbidden by antivirus) | HTTP(通信プロトコル) 4
10 tar | Linuxコマンド 4
10 Python 3.6 インストール / make altinstall | Python(プログラミング言語) 4
10 「CentOS6」から「CentOS7」への移行 | CentOS 7 (CentOS) 4
10 echo と cat の違い 4
2021/9/21 1:01 更新